Being the Report of the Court of Their Majesties, Malcolm and Tessa,  
King and Queen of Æthelmearc with the Landed Nobility of the Kingdom  
of Æthelmearc in attendance.  Court held September 16, AS 41 (2006)  
at the Coronation of Christopher and Morgen in Their Barony-Marche of  
the Debatable Lands. Giulietta da Venezia, Reporting Herald, with the  
assistance of THLord Cadell Blaidd Du.

Corwyn ap Nennius the Dirge was made a Companion of the Sycamore in  
absentia for his skill in the bardic arts.  Scroll limned by Lord  
Ardal of Antioch, scrivened and authored by Lady Sarra Moore.

Maddelina d'Angeles was given a Sigil of Æthelmearc for her service  
to Their Majesties during Their Reign, most particularly for her  
excellent care of Katherine, the Princess Royale.

Silence de Cherbourg was made a Companion of the Sycamore for her  
skill in the bardic arts.  Scroll by Their Excellencies, Boudiccea  
Ravenhair and Ekaterina Volkova.

Their Majesties invited Their Heir, Sir Christopher Rawlyns, Crown  
Prince of Æthelmearc, to attend Them.  His Highness spoke of Their  
Majesties' defense of the Kingdom during two wars, and of the great  
service done by Them in furtherance of our Kingdom's greatness.  He  
expressed His wish to take up the burden of the Crown, that Their  
Majesties might retire to Their hillside estates overlooking the  
Debatable Lands' three rivers, and enjoy Their well-earned rest.  
Their Majesties agreed that a period of respite would be most  
pleasant, but noted that They had further matters of state needing  
attention. His Highness agreed to return once Their Majesties'  
business had concluded.

Their Majesties called forth Their Guard, thanked them for their  
service, and dismissed all but His Excellency, Vladisla Nikulich.

Vladisla Nikulich was given a Sigil of Æthelmearc for his service to  
Their Majesties during Their Reign, most particularly for his service  
as Captain of Her Majesty's guard.

Once again, Their Majesties invited His Highness, Christopher to  
attend Them.  His Highness asserted His claim to be Their Majesties'  
true Heir by right of arms.  Their Majesties asked for witnesses to  
attest to His Highness' claim.

Sir Magariki Katsuichi no Koredono, Earl Marshal of Æthelmearc,  
attested that he had been present at Their Majesties' Crown  
Tournament, that the Tournament had been properly conducted in  
keeping with the laws, policies and customs of the Kingdom, and that  
Sir Christopher was the right and true victor.

Her Excellency, Marguerite de la Marche, Seneschal of Æthelmearc,  
attested that she also had been present at Their Majesties' Crown  
Tournament, that the laws, policies and customs of the Kingdom had  
been observed, and that Sir Christopher was the right and true victor.

Her Excellency, Giulietta da Venezia, Silver Buccle Principal Herald  
of Æthelmearc, attested that she also had been present at Their  
Majesties' Crown Tournament, that she witnessed the victory of Sir  
Christopher, and that she proclaimed Him Their Majesties' right and  
true Heir before Their Majesties, the populace and the entire Known  
World.

His Majesty then addressed Her Majesty and thanked Her for her  
service as Queen, for her care of Himself and His populace, and for  
her tireless efforts on behalf of the Kingdom and its people.  He  
noted that it would be most pleasant to retire with Her to their  
Estates, and she agreed.  His Majesty then removed the Crown from Her  
Majesty's head, and allowed her to retire.

His Highness knelt before His Majesty, who removed the Crown from His  
head, received Christopher's Oath of Fealty, crowned Christopher the  
nineteenth King of Æthelmearc, and retired.

Thus did the Court and Reign of Malcolm and Tessa come to an end.
